CrazyMax
|
f9b34f0e95
|
Merge pull request #4 from crazy-max/buildx-version
buildx: do not set version in constructor
|
2023-01-30 20:11:23 +01:00 |
|
CrazyMax
|
32a260e6e5
|
buildx: do not set version in constructor
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 20:08:54 +01:00 |
|
CrazyMax
|
5360816e7b
|
Merge pull request #3 from docker/ci-publish
ci: fix publish workflow
|
2023-01-30 11:19:26 +01:00 |
|
CrazyMax
|
e39eef321f
|
ci: fix publish workflow
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 11:15:39 +01:00 |
|
CrazyMax
|
581e356545
|
Merge pull request #2 from docker/update-deps
update dependencies
|
2023-01-30 03:41:09 +01:00 |
|
CrazyMax
|
111908ddc3
|
update dependencies
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 03:36:26 +01:00 |
|
CrazyMax
|
4c7e288e17
|
Merge pull request #1 from docker/yarn-v3
update to Yarn 3.3.1
|
2023-01-30 03:27:17 +01:00 |
|
CrazyMax
|
5fd129bc82
|
update to Yarn 3.3.1
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 03:22:04 +01:00 |
|
CrazyMax
|
9a5a2907f5
|
toolkit: fix export
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 03:20:29 +01:00 |
|
CrazyMax
|
039779492c
|
test: githubActionsRuntimeToken
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 03:08:12 +01:00 |
|
CrazyMax
|
85ef93202e
|
move GitHub specific to its own class
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 02:31:09 +01:00 |
|
CrazyMax
|
bb369fa859
|
buildx: getProvenanceInput, getProvenanceAttrs
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 00:57:38 +01:00 |
|
CrazyMax
|
0ec088fbda
|
test(buildx): correctly sort tests
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 00:26:20 +01:00 |
|
CrazyMax
|
4259682b27
|
buildx: printInspect
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 00:19:03 +01:00 |
|
CrazyMax
|
c857b8425c
|
global enhancements
- create context object and remove github one
- more tests and improve mocks
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-30 00:08:45 +01:00 |
|
CrazyMax
|
b03f6a405c
|
github: add serverURL annd provenanceBuilderID
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-25 03:20:18 +01:00 |
|
CrazyMax
|
380149da27
|
buildx: reduce calls to getVersion
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-25 02:49:21 +01:00 |
|
CrazyMax
|
d27b5d60be
|
buildx: optional version for versionSatisfies
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-24 01:43:01 +01:00 |
|
CrazyMax
|
b6f85576fa
|
noop on cmd call test
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-24 01:21:36 +01:00 |
|
CrazyMax
|
66653922b3
|
test: clear mocks
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-24 00:50:22 +01:00 |
|
CrazyMax
|
251b9d49f3
|
test: set GITHUB_TOKEN secret
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-24 00:37:33 +01:00 |
|
CrazyMax
|
fe75972f55
|
buildx: printVersion
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-24 00:13:52 +01:00 |
|
CrazyMax
|
4f2a155c08
|
docker: split version and info
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-24 00:06:31 +01:00 |
|
CrazyMax
|
3c101c4aee
|
buildx: hadDockerExporter
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 23:58:13 +01:00 |
|
CrazyMax
|
14581244a3
|
buildx: expose methods
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 15:11:35 +01:00 |
|
CrazyMax
|
fdc8b5d37b
|
docker: set default standalone
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 14:48:00 +01:00 |
|
CrazyMax
|
fe07aec685
|
test(git): increase timeout
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 14:15:39 +01:00 |
|
CrazyMax
|
1b8e89676e
|
buildx: check standalone
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 14:08:52 +01:00 |
|
CrazyMax
|
595e2417e8
|
docker: info method
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 10:39:14 +01:00 |
|
CrazyMax
|
aae4a2d7bc
|
Some improvements
- Use classes
- Split buildx/builder modules
- Additional tests
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 10:07:14 +01:00 |
|
CrazyMax
|
c7dfb4c220
|
Dockerfile: use test-coverage target
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 10:05:35 +01:00 |
|
CrazyMax
|
72447c98b0
|
Dockerfile: missing buildx standalone
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 10:03:33 +01:00 |
|
CrazyMax
|
68e4223857
|
Dockerfile: test-coverage target
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-23 01:38:28 +01:00 |
|
CrazyMax
|
3d197dfdf1
|
fix config for publication
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-22 22:50:08 +01:00 |
|
CrazyMax
|
c8aae7be2d
|
prepare package release
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-22 21:22:42 +01:00 |
|
CrazyMax
|
30d19b72d3
|
ci: disable codecov for now
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:08:14 +01:00 |
|
CrazyMax
|
87b31c49d0
|
codecov config
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:08:13 +01:00 |
|
CrazyMax
|
ef46dc398f
|
gha workflows
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:07:30 +01:00 |
|
CrazyMax
|
806b4fefa6
|
dependabot
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:07:05 +01:00 |
|
CrazyMax
|
e787e99036
|
dockerfile to build and run tests
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:07:05 +01:00 |
|
CrazyMax
|
70326fd842
|
initial implementation
carries most of the logic used across our actions
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:07:05 +01:00 |
|
CrazyMax
|
3b6c627995
|
contributing docs
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:01:22 +01:00 |
|
CrazyMax
|
568549c1dc
|
LICENSE
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:01:18 +01:00 |
|
CrazyMax
|
956c3707d7
|
initial commit
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
2023-01-17 12:01:03 +01:00 |
|